With an art background at the National School of Painting, Sculpture, and Engraving, La Esmeralda, Christian Castañeda (Mexico City, 1982) has a highly individual aesthetic sensibility. Her work, which includes drawing, painting, ceramics, and installation, has been exhibited in solo and group exhibitions in Mexico and abroad. Additionally, her work has been published and reviewed internationally in magazines and digital media. This multidisciplinary personality has led her to the art of tattooing, where she currently develops as Xian of the Death.
